iamsuperdan Posted March 15, 2016 Share Posted March 15, 2016 (edited) Another built I never really got pics of before. Picked up this Galaxie 20ft car hauler. Pretty simple kit, went together well though. Kits comes with a ton of decals, so lots of options for logos, plates, warning labels, etc. Could probably spend a little more time detailing the interior, make it a little more realistic. I have the Galaxie 38ft 5th wheel trailer, so may play with that one a little more. Just need to build a decent pickup kit now to display this properly. And make some Alberta license plates for it. iamsuperdan Posted March 16, 2016 Author Share Posted March 16, 2016 Nice trailer, but where's the Audi from?The Audi 80 is a Fujimi kit. Nice kit...right until final assembly. The chassis does not fit into the body nicely. 4X4 ride height. Even if I remove the interior, it still sits ridiculously high.
